Summary & Background

Beginning with the 2016-2017 program year, the city became a direct recipient of funds from the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) through the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) program.  This ordinance accepts the funds awarded for program year 2022. 

 

The 2022 Annual Action Plan will be presented by Community Development staff.  This ordinance was drafted to include the funding submitted for your consideration/approval.  The projects to be presented in the 2022 Annual Action Plan are public services, public works, economic development, housing rehabilitation, and/or administration costs.
